 RenderPackage

using Autodesk.DesignScript.Interfaces; using System; using System.Collections.Generic; using System.Linq; namespace Dynamo.DSEngine { public class RenderPackage : IRenderPackage, IDisposable { private IntPtr nativeRenderPackage; private List<double> lineStripVertices = new List<double>(); private List<byte> lineStripVertexColors = new List<byte>(); private List<int> lineStripVertexCounts = new List<int>(); private List<double> pointVertices = new List<double>(); private List<byte> pointVertexColors = new List<byte>(); private List<double> triangleVertices = new List<double>(); private List<byte> triangleVertexColor = new List<byte>(); private List<double> triangleNormals = new List<double>(); public bool Selected { get; set; } public bool DisplayLabels { get; set; } public string Tag { get; set; } public List<double> LineStripVertices { get { return lineStripVertices; } set { lineStripVertices = value; } } public List<double> PointVertices { get { return pointVertices; } set { pointVertices = value; } } public List<double> TriangleVertices { get { return triangleVertices; } set { triangleVertices = value; } } public List<double> TriangleNormals { get { return triangleNormals; } set { triangleNormals = value; } } public List<byte> LineStripVertexColors { get { return lineStripVertexColors; } set { lineStripVertexColors = value; } } public List<int> LineStripVertexCounts { get { return lineStripVertexCounts; } set { lineStripVertexCounts = value; } } public List<byte> PointVertexColors { get { return pointVertexColors; } set { pointVertexColors = value; } } public List<byte> TriangleVertexColors { get { return triangleVertexColor; } set { triangleVertexColor = value; } } public int ItemsCount { get; set; } public IntPtr NativeRenderPackage => nativeRenderPackage; public RenderPackage() { Tag = string.Empty; ItemsCount = 0; } public RenderPackage(bool selected, bool displayLabels) { Selected = selected; DisplayLabels = displayLabels; Tag = string.Empty; ItemsCount = 0; } public void Clear() { lineStripVertices.Clear(); lineStripVertexColors.Clear(); lineStripVertexCounts.Clear(); pointVertices.Clear(); pointVertexColors.Clear(); triangleVertices.Clear(); triangleVertexColor.Clear(); triangleNormals.Clear(); Tag = string.Empty; ItemsCount = 0; } public void PushLineStripVertex(double x, double y, double z) { lineStripVertices.Add(x); lineStripVertices.Add(y); lineStripVertices.Add(z); } public void PushLineStripVertexColor(byte red, byte green, byte blue, byte alpha) { lineStripVertexColors.Add(red); lineStripVertexColors.Add(green); lineStripVertexColors.Add(blue); lineStripVertexColors.Add(alpha); } public void PushLineStripVertexCount(int n) { lineStripVertexCounts.Add(n); } public void PushPointVertex(double x, double y, double z) { pointVertices.Add(x); pointVertices.Add(y); pointVertices.Add(z); } public void PushPointVertexColor(byte red, byte green, byte blue, byte alpha) { pointVertexColors.Add(red); pointVertexColors.Add(green); pointVertexColors.Add(blue); pointVertexColors.Add(alpha); } public void PushTriangleVertex(double x, double y, double z) { triangleVertices.Add(x); triangleVertices.Add(y); triangleVertices.Add(z); } public void PushTriangleVertexColor(byte red, byte green, byte blue, byte alpha) { triangleVertexColor.Add(red); triangleVertexColor.Add(green); triangleVertexColor.Add(blue); triangleVertexColor.Add(alpha); } public void PushTriangleVertexNormal(double x, double y, double z) { triangleNormals.Add(x); triangleNormals.Add(y); triangleNormals.Add(z); } public void Dispose() { } public bool IsNotEmpty() { return lineStripVertices.Any() || pointVertices.Any() || triangleVertices.Any(); } } }
